eliminate some global references to interpreter internals
* bp-table.h, bp-table.cc (bp_table::m_interpreter): New data member.
(get_user_code): Deprecate.
* interpreter.h, interpreter.cc (interpreter::get_user_code):
New function. Change all uses of global get_uesr_code to use
interpreter::get_user_code instead.
